Subject: Quickstore 4.2 — bloom filter now fronts the KV layer

Plugin authors: starting with this release, Quickstore places a bloom filter ahead of the key-value store. Negative lookups return faster; false positives fall through safely. No API changes are required on your side. Verify your plugin against the staging build referenced below.

session token of fahif-tadup = htk3_9c7

## Build Provenance — Coldpath Handlers

Cold starts on the Murkfield serverless tier are provenance-sensitive: the init snapshot is baked at build time, so any unverified layer inflates startup by ~800ms. Always rebuild handlers from the pinned base image; never patch layers in place. Provenance attestations live alongside each artifact in the Coldpath store. When auditing a slow cold start, match the deployed snapshot against the token that follows.

build token for yaweg-fawig: htk4_45ef

# Restockly planner settings — eng sync notes
# Planner computes weekly refill routes for vending fleets.
# Demand model retrains Sundays; don't restart workers mid-run.
# route_horizon_days: keep at 7 unless ops approves.
# stale_inventory_hours: 48 triggers a forced resync.
# Known issue: planner double-counts machines moved between zones;
# fix targeted for next sprint.
# The planner reads inventory snapshots from the store referenced by the connection string below.

replica DSN, fadup-yagug: mssql://rusox_svc:0K2wrVJefbkR2n@db-53b3.qirvangrid.example:5432/istix

Hi, and welcome to the Splitgate on-call rotation!

Splitgate is our A/B experiment assignment service — every client request for a variant flows through it, so even brief degradation skews experiment data downstream. The most common pages involve stale bucket caches and the nightly config sync from Trellane. Please read the escalation policy carefully before your first shift, and don't hesitate to ping the secondary. The full on-call guide lives at the internal page below.

dashboard of kafof-tahaf = https://confluence.tolvaqsys.internal/projects/browse/display/a1250987